As a Quality Inspector, you will be responsible for ensuring that products meet both internal and customer requirements. Working closely with the Quality Manager and production teams, your key duties will include:

  • Conducting final inspections of pharmaceutical products
  • Monitoring product quality throughout the production process, including random checks
  • Training given.
  • Supporting production operators with quality‐related queries
  • Participating in internal audits, including process, Health & Safety, housekeeping and glass/brittle plastic audits (full training provided)
  • Assisting with documentation for Quality and Health & Safety systems
  • Contributing to process control improvement projects

Ideally you will have proficiency in Microsoft Word and Excel, quality control experience and strong communication and interpersonal skills. Full training will be provided for internal auditing responsibilities.
